Head Start of Muskegon/Oceana

Head Start of Muskegon/Oceana Head Start of Muskegon/Oceana serves 995 preschool children (ages three - five) throughout Muskegon & Oceana Counties. There is no cost to attend (it's free!).

More than 15 classroom sites are located throughout the two counties. Free bus transportation is provided from children's homes to the classrooms, which operate Monday - Thursday during the school year in half-day sessions (both morning and afternoon). Early Head Start serves 76 pregnant women and children ages birth to three in either center-based child care setting or by visiting homes weekly.

Did you know you can stretch your food dollars while supporting local farmers at the Muskegon Farmers Market?

With Double Up Food Bucks, every dollar you spend using SNAP/EBT on fresh fruits and vegetables is matched (up to $50) —helping you bring home more healthy, local food for your family.

💚 Eat more fresh, Michigan-grown produce
💚 Support hardworking local farmers
💚 Make your food budget go further

It’s a win for you, a win for farmers, and a win for our community.

🎂 Happy 61st Birthday, Head Start!

Sixty-one years ago, a bold idea took root: every child — no matter their zip code or family income — deserves a strong start in life. What began as an 8-week summer program in 1965 has since served more than 38 million children and counting.

Today, Head Start programs across all 50 states, D.C., Puerto Rico, and U.S. territories continue that promise every single day — offering early education, health screenings, nutritious meals, and deep family support.
